In this presentation, learn how a pop-up library can be used as an outreach approach to cultivate a welcoming community. Learn how partnerships and targeted outreach opportunities can help customize the pop-up library experience and work to your advantage.

Pop-up libraries are great ways to highlight collections, showcase a variety of services, and facilitate opportunities to engage with the library in a low-stress, inviting way.
